What is effective wind turbine maintenance?

Effective wind turbine maintenance involves a combination of preventive, predictive, and corrective measures, tailored to the specific needs of each wind turbine. Gaining a thorough understanding of wind turbine components is crucial for carrying out these tasks effectively.

How Do You Reach Long-Term Success with Maintenance and Inspection Strategies?Identify Failures to Limit and Avoid DamageAvoid Downtime with The Right Maintenance and Monitoring ApproachRegular and Appropriate Inspection Helps Maintain Your InstallationOperation and maintenance costs make up a significant part of the total annual costs of a wind turbine. During the first five years of operation, the turbines would all be under warranty, but after that point, the burden of maintenance falls on the wind farm owner.
